ogre shaman on the bard diet?
Was just considering maybe going on the bard diet for a while on my ogre shaman, and I don't think the faction hits would really bother me, and maybe i could get my mayong mistmoore faction high enough to somehow make camping black dire easier for later? Is there any faction hits I should care about, or any good reason why I shouldn't kill some bards?

If you're doing a L25 bard, make it the one in Feerrot by the Innothule zoneline - she gives the best cash (better than Travis in Nektulos etc)
